The Board of Directors for the South Florida Affiliate of Susan G. Komen for the Cure® is lead by an Executive Committee.  This group of dedicated volunteers demonstrates their passion for the fight to beat breast cancer with their leadership and service.


President
Dave Ragsdale

Dave’s involvement with the Affiliate dates back to the first Race back in 1991. As a local runner, Dave and his wife, Molly, ran in the Race every year. His volunteering with the Affiliate began in 2002 as a Race course consultant. From there, Dave headed up the Site Operations team for several years before serving as the first-ever Male Co-Chair in 2005 and Race Chair in 2006. That year, the Race broke through the $1 Million mark for the first time. Since then, Dave’s voice can be heard on Race Day down at the start line organizing the event and encouraging all the participants.

Dave travels all over the U.S. announcing triathlons and running races and is the Associate Publisher of Competitor Magazine. He is a 1978 graduate of Colgate University.

 

 


Treasurer
Teresa A. Licamara

Teresa Licamara has been volunteering for the Affiliate since 2008. She currently serves as the Treasurer and previously served as Treasurer Elect for two years.

Teresa is currently employed as a Manager in the advisory division of MarcumRachlin in West Palm Beach, FL. She has provided forensic accounting services to Bankruptcy Trustee’s and court appointed Receivers for over 10 years. Teresa is a Certified Public Accountant, Accredited in Business Valuations, Certified Insolvency Restructuring Advisor and Certified in Financial Forensics. She holds a BS in Accounting and an MBA, both from Nova Southeastern University.

 

 


Secretary
Mary Booher

Mary has a longtime record for community volunteer service. Her commitment to Susan G. Komen for the Cure® began in 1990 during the first organizational planning for the South Florida Affiliate of Susan G. Komen for the Cure®, the first Komen for the Cure and Race for the Cure presence in Florida. Mary was a founding Board of Directors member and remains the only continuing member of the original founding board. Since serving as Co-Chair of the Komen South Florida Race for the Cure in 2000-2001, she has served as 2002 Race Chair, 2003 Consulting Chair, and has continued each year to serve as Race Advisor and member of the Race Planning Committee, working year round.

She has special interest and experience with community and corporate relationships, fundraising, media outreach, and ongoing creative strategies. (Note: Mary’s 2002 Race Chair description, “No Better Place,” is re-printed with her permission on this website).


Member At Large
Elizabeth DeWoody

Elizabeth credits her early breast cancer diagnosis to the Susan G. Komen Race for the Cure®. She volunteered for the Komen South Florida Race for the Cure in 2004 as the Food and Beverage Chair and was diagnosed with stage 1 breast cancer in 2005. She is forever grateful to Susan G. Komen for making her aware that her family history dictated that she should ask for a mammogram at age 38 versus 40. Due to her diagnosis through early detection, she will live a long healthy life with her husband and two children. Elizabeth was honored to serve as Race Chair in 2007 and help the Affiliate raise $1.7 million dollars to raise awareness locally and assure that we eradicate breast cancer as a life threatening disease. She has been volunteering for the Affiliate as a Board Member for the past four years. Elizabeth currently sits on the Grants Committee and is Co-Chair of the Development Committee.

Prior to her volunteer work, Elizabeth worked in Sales Management and Marketing with Procter and Gamble Distributing Company and Vistakon Inc, Johnson and Johnson. She holds a BS in Marketing from Florida State University and MBA from University of Miami.
